Timothy B. Schmit: A Musical Legend
Before we talk about Timothy's cancer battle, let's give a quick nod to his incredible musical career. Born on October 30, 1947, in Oakland, California, Timothy Bruce Schmit is a renowned American musician, singer, and songwriter. He's best known for his time with the Eagles, where he played bass and sang harmony and lead vocals. Some of his most iconic contributions include "I Can't Tell You Why" and "Love Will Keep Us Alive."
